About Senior Payroll Specialist

  Job Summary

  Senior Payroll Specialists are responsible for the day-to-day processes related to their assigned paygroups and entities while ensuring accurate and timely pay to employees while involved in data audits, reconciliations, validation of tax filings and other tasks as assigned.

  Core Responsibilities

  Process weekly payrolls including off-cycles for assigned paygroups with approximately 500-1000+ employees

  Daily review of timecard or time and labor system for discrepancies and communicate to Supervisors as needed

  Review and edit of timesheet data as requested

  Review and process new hires, change requests and special pay during payroll processing

  Prepare reconciliations, validate totals and finalize documentation to submit for review for assigned payrolls

  Print, sort and ship payroll checks when needed

  Calculate and process final pay according to state and union requirements and regulations

  Coordinate pay garnishments, child support, lien payments, etc. with 3rd party vendor

  Work closely with HR department to ensure correct employee data

  Ensure appropriate record retention, maintain data and files for payroll processing

  Resolve payroll discrepancies by collecting and analyzing information

  Ensure timely reporting and payment to employees, while following union, state and federal regulations and company policies

  Research, analyze and resolve payroll-related problems or questions in a timely manner

  Handle detail audits of payroll data including reconciliations on a monthly/quarterly basis

  Create certified payroll reporting and monthly union billing remittance through accurate calculation of hours and applicable union rates and benefits

  Makes suggestions for change and/or improvements, implements changes when necessary

  Create and distribute payroll related reports as required or requested

  Provide excellent customer service by assisting employees and managers with questions

  Maintain process and procedure documentation

  Other duties or projects as assigned or apparent

  Work Experience

  Minimum of 5 years of payroll processing experience.

  Education/Training

  High school diploma or equivalent. CPP or FPC certification highly preferred.

  Specialized Knowledge Certificates & Licenses

  As outlined in the Core Responsibilities, an individual must have thorough knowledge and an advanced understanding of each competency above in order to carry out the essential functions of this position. Specialized Knowledge is also required in the following areas:

  Strong knowledge and understanding of Payroll Practices and regulations as they relate to federal and state requirements, garnishments, levies, fines, and fees at the federal, state, and local levels

  Advanced analytical, critical thinking and problem-solving skills

  Advanced Excel skills required ability to create pivot tables, reconciliations, vlookups, etc

  Union reporting and certified payroll processing experience a plus

  Proficient with payroll softwares including ADP WorkforceNow

  Thorough knowledge of Payroll Practices and regulations as they relate to federal and state requirements, garnishments, levies, fines, and fees at the federal, state, and local levels

  Ability to multi-task and prioritize workloads and schedules efficiently

  Must be a team player and work effectively with all types of diverse personalities

  Must be highly detail-oriented and very organized with the ability to adapt to a changing environment

  High degree of accuracy and attention to detail

  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le highly sensitive and personal information with sound judgement, tact and discretion
